pub struct SideOffsets2D<T, U> {
pub top: T,
pub right: T,
pub bottom: T,
pub left: T,
/* private fields */
}Expand description
A group of 2D side offsets, which correspond to top/right/bottom/left for borders, padding, and margins in CSS, optionally tagged with a unit.

Source§impl<T, U> SideOffsets2D<T, U>
impl<T, U> SideOffsets2D<T, U>
Sourcepub const fn new(top: T, right: T, bottom: T, left: T) -> SideOffsets2D<T, U>
pub const fn new(top: T, right: T, bottom: T, left: T) -> SideOffsets2D<T, U>
Constructor taking a scalar for each side.
Sides are specified in top-right-bottom-left order following CSS’s convention.
